About This Course

This course delves into the intricate world of commercial real estate leasing, focusing on drafting letters of intent (LOIs) and comprehensive lease agreements. With expert insights from Kenneth W. Brzyski, an experienced attorney in commercial litigation and leasing, participants will gain a thorough understanding of the essential elements, common pitfalls, and strategic negotiation tactics in commercial leasing. Through practical examples, case studies, and detailed explanations, this course is designed to equip legal professionals with the knowledge and skills to effectively navigate commercial lease transactions.

Kenneth W. Biedzynski
Kenneth W. Biedzynski

Partner at Law Offices of Goldzweig, Green, Eiger & Biedzynski, L.L.C.

Kenneth W. Biedzynski’s practice focuses on landlord-tenant law, personal injury, and commercial litigation. Mr. Biedzynski serves as Special Counsel to Marlboro Township for COAH/Affordable Housing matters and serves as the Board Attorney for the Marlboro Township Affordable Housing Agency and Rent Control Board. He is a member of the Monmouth County Bar Association and the New Jersey State Bar Association. A graduate of Kean University, Mr. Biedzynski received his J.D. from Seton Hall University.
